xeromorphic
[zeer-uh-mawr-fik]
adjective
of or relating to structural adaptations of xerophytes that help them store water and withstand drought.
xeromorphic
/ ˌɪəəˈɔːɪ /
adjective
(of plants or plant parts) having characteristics that serve as protection against excessive loss of water

51Թ History and Origins
Origin of xeromorphic1
First recorded in 1905–10; xero- ( def. ) + -morphic ( def. )
